Description

RINGMORE VILLAGE CENTRE SX 64 NE 5/181 Hill Cottage

GV II

Detached cottage. C18. Limewashed rubble, cob upper level, thatched roof. Probably symmetrical block with both rooms heated, extended left by one bay, or incorporating outbuilding. Two storeys, 3 windows, mainly 2-light glazing bar casements, and to eyebrows at upper level. Low left, ground floor, larger 2-light sash casement 9-pane, and to right of door a 3-light. C20 door to thatched hood on wood brackets between bays 2 and 3; cropped stack to right, and larger stack, left, possibly external originally. To left the thatch sweeps down in a hip and above an outbuilding, possibly a donkey house; this has plank doors in the return, under a small rectangular opening, perhaps to former hay loft; beyond is former doorway, now with 2-light casement with glazing bars. Wing at back not of special interest. Interior has been considerably modified; fireplace to left, but not in right room, some evidence of staircase by fire- place. Roof not inspected. The cottage lies across the slope of the road and runs back into hillside.
